Comfort

A quality double pushchair with 3 wheels should be comfortable for both baby and parents with a padded seat and hood that protects their heads. There are a variety of colours, fabrics, and accessories available to suit your personal style. Certain models come with a lie flat mode for babies and most models have different positions that can recline. Some are also light making them easy to lift into the boot, or up and down kerbs.

Look for features that will make your ride more comfortable, such as a soft suspension or a large basket. Some models come with a clever frame that expands widthways to accommodate the second seat, meaning you can fit them through narrow entrances and are more manoeuvrable in rough terrain. Some models have a neat standing fold that makes use of less space in storage. Others have a bag for transporting the buggy.

Side-by-side buggies are generally bigger than single buggies, however certain models, like the Roma Gemini, manage to be lighter and still feel comfortable enough to be used in cities or in theme parks. They are also typically easier to get to and from kerbs, unlike other twin-seaters due to their more evenly weight distribution. Many can be used from the age of newborn to about four years old, and some can be fitted with carrycots or car seats to extend the lifespan of the seat.

Some even allow for a trio of kids by incorporating a buggy board for older children who are mobile (UPPAbaby Vist V2 Double). It's worth remembering that while most manufacturers specify a maximum weight per seat and perhaps a total frame weight, it's impossible to know how much your child will grow until they reach the age of toddlers.

Ultimately, a great way to decide how well a double pushchair 3 wheeler is to test it out in person, so that you can observe how easy it is to manoeuvre with two children in the seat. Ask the shop if they are able to provide a demonstration or hire agreement to help you get a better feel for a model.

Safety

A double pushchair with three wheels can provide more stability than a model with four wheels and is safer if you walk regularly in the countryside. Regular pushchairs with small wheels are prone to getting clogged with sticks, grass and mud, making them difficult to steer. On the other the other hand, a double pushchair with three wheels will have big back wheels that take up the majority of the space, meaning you're not likely to hit anything.

All-terrain strollers such as the Roma Gemini are ideal for those who live in areas that have bumpy and rough terrain. This model has large, puncture resistant all-terrain tires and a sturdy suspension that allows it to move around any surface without issue.
